From personal trainers to yoga instructors, fitness coaching has often been seen as a young man’s game, a short-term part-time job for 20-somethings fitness enthusiasts, as opposed to a full-time professional career. And those who do want to stay in the industry long-term often assume the only way to do it is to open their own gym. 

CrossFit, however, has changed all this.

Today, more and more CrossFit coaches have been in the industry for 10-plus years, proving it’s possible to pursue a full-time, professional career as a coach without having to be a gym owner to make a real living. 

James McDermott, Alex Samaniego, Michael Bann, Chris Schaalo and Junior Delfin are five of them. Each of them has been coaching for at least a decade and have become full-time, professionals intent on being lifelong, career coaches.

McDermott in Albany, NY

McDermott began coaching at Albany CrossFit in New York 10 years ago as an intern coach while he was studying Kinesiology in college. A decade later, he’s still there, only now he’s the affiliate’s General Manager.

His role involves coaching 15 classes a week, including both CrossFit and Barbell Club classes. The rest of McDermott’s time is spent doing the gym’s programming and working on other aspects of the business, from bringing on new clients to social media.
